When a patient needs their medical records transferred to a new provider, a signed authorization is legally required. But crafting a release form that covers all the bases—patient identity, records scope, recipient details, expiration—can be tedious. Mistakes or omissions can delay care or violate privacy rules.

Switching Primary Care Physicians

A patient moves to a new city and needs their complete medical history transferred from their old PCP to a new one. You need a release form that clearly lists the sending provider, receiving provider, and scope of records (e.g., all records since 2018). Specialist Referral Records Request

A cardiologist requires the patient's recent lab results and imaging reports from their general practitioner. The release must specify the exact documents needed and an expiration date. Legal or Insurance Claim Support

A patient needs to authorize release of records to their attorney for a disability claim. The form must be precise about the time frame and include a clause permitting the attorney to receive copies.
